Chewy, spicy, garlicky goodness in every bite These Garlic Chili Oil Noodles come together with sizzling hot oil, then get topped with a crispy fried egg and fresh cucumber. Simple ingredients, BIG flavor—and so satisfying! Serves 2 Ingredients 8 oz knife-cut noodles 5 cloves garlic, finely minced 1 tsp chili flakes 2 green onions, thinly sliced 3 tbsp soy sauce 1 tbsp rice vinegar 1 tsp sesame oil 1 tsp sugar 1 tbsp garlic chili oil ¼ cup neutral oil, such as avocado oil For Garnish 1–2 fried eggs ½ cucumber, thinly sliced or julienned Sesame seeds Sliced green onions, optional Extra garlic chili oil, optional Instructions Cook the knife-cut noodles according to package directions until tender and chewy.  In a large heat-safe bowl, add the minced garlic, chili flakes, and sliced green onions, soy sauce, rice vinegar, sesame oil, sugar, garlic chili oil. Heat the avocado oil in a small saucepan until very hot and shimmering, but not smoking. Carefully pour the hot oil over the mixture. It should sizzle immediately. Stir until the sugar dissolves and everything is well combined. Add the hot drained noodles directly to the bowl. Toss thoroughly until the noodles are evenly coated and glossy. Divide the noodles between bowls. Top each serving with a fried egg and fresh sliced or julienned cucumber. Sprinkle with sesame seeds and sliced green onions. Add an extra drizzle of garlic chili oil for more heat, if desired.
